What Repentance Truly Means
Repentance is frequently defined as turning away from sin and returning to God, but it carries much deeper significance. It's a heart posture that recognizes the gravity of our actions and their impact on our relationship with God. Prophetic voices like Rick Renner remind us that true repentance is a radical change of heart, involving humility, sorrow for wrongdoing, and a commitment to change. In a world swamped with distraction and temptation, re-establishing this practice is crucial for spiritual health.
Historical Context of Repentance
Throughout the Bible, repentance has been a recurrent theme, from the appeals of the prophets in the Old Testament to Jesus’ call for repentance in the New Testament. God’s requirement for repentance signals His desire for restoration and reconciliation. Reflecting on these biblical precedents encourages believers to examine their own lives and collectively seek God's favor through heartfelt repentance.
